Features Comparison

Gcore Web Application and API Protection

  • AI-Driven WAF

    WAF using regex, signatures, heuristics, and behavioral analytics to protect against OWASP Top 10 and beyond. Custom rules and device fingerprinting for advanced detection.

  • Bot Management

    Distinguishes good bots from malicious ones using behavioral analytics, JavaScript challenges, CAPTCHA, session management, and rate limiting.

  • L7 DDoS Mitigation

    Application-layer DDoS protection with burst identification, AI-based IP filtering, and auto-scaling at the edge.

  • API Security

    Protects APIs against OWASP API Top 10 with ML-based filtering, JA3 fingerprinting, and heuristic analysis.

  • Edge Deployment

    All processing happens at Gcore's 180+ edge PoPs for minimal latency impact on legitimate traffic.

  • Auto-Learning

    Self-tuning capabilities that adapt protection rules based on observed traffic patterns and new threat types.

Solid Security (formerly iThemes Security)

  • Patchstack Firewall

    Virtual patching rules powered by Patchstack that protect against known plugin and theme vulnerabilities automatically.

  • Two-Factor Authentication

    Multiple 2FA methods including authenticator apps, email codes, and backup codes for all user roles.

  • Passwordless Login

    Login via passkeys and biometrics, eliminating password-based attacks entirely (Pro feature).

  • Site Scanner

    Checks for known malware, vulnerabilities in plugins and themes, and blocklist status.

  • File Change Detection

    Monitors WordPress core files and alerts when unexpected changes are detected.

  • Security Dashboard

    Unified dashboard showing security status, recent events, and actionable recommendations.

  • Trusted Devices

    Recognizes trusted devices and restricts admin access from unknown devices (Pro feature).
